What document capture software does

Document capture software collects information from paper documents, emails or digital files, identifies the relevant data and sends the document and its data to an agreed destination. That destination might be a document management platform, accounts system, CRM, shared folder, cloud storage location or a structured approval workflow.

The process often begins at a multifunction device. A user can scan a supplier invoice, delivery note or employee form and select a simple on-screen option. The software applies consistent rules in the background: it may recognise the document type, read key fields, name the file correctly and route it to the appropriate queue.

Optical character recognition, commonly known as OCR, is central to many capture workflows. It converts text in a scanned image into searchable information. More advanced tools can extract values such as invoice numbers, purchase order references, dates and supplier names. However, extraction accuracy depends on the quality and consistency of source documents. A clear, standardised invoice is easier to process than a handwritten form or a poor photocopy.

That distinction matters. Good capture software should reduce manual effort, not create a new exception-handling burden. The right design includes validation steps for uncertain data, so users only review the information that genuinely needs attention.


Where manual document handling creates pressure

Many businesses still rely on a mixture of email attachments, shared drives, paper trays and personal knowledge. An invoice arrives at reception, is scanned to a generic mailbox, then waits for someone to forward it. A signed delivery note sits on a desk until a query arises. An HR form is saved with an inconsistent name in a folder only one person understands.

These processes may appear manageable at low volumes, but the operational cost becomes clear when someone is absent, an audit request arrives or a customer needs an answer quickly. Staff spend time searching rather than progressing work. Finance teams chase approvals. IT teams inherit uncontrolled shared folders. Sensitive documents are copied more widely than necessary.

Document capture is particularly useful where a process involves repeated document types, a clear owner and a predictable next step. Accounts payable, onboarding, case files, job sheets, purchase documentation and customer correspondence are common examples. The aim is not to digitise every piece of paper for its own sake. It is to remove friction from the documents that repeatedly slow the organisation down.


Document capture software is more than scanning

A scanner creates an image. A capture workflow gives that image context, ownership and a route forward. This is why the software should be considered alongside devices, print management, access controls and the systems teams already use.


Capture at the point of work

A well-configured multifunction device can present users with clear scan options based on their role or department. Rather than asking users to remember email addresses, folder paths and file naming rules, the device guides them to the correct workflow. This reduces errors at source and makes adoption easier for occasional users.

For organisations with multiple locations, cloud-enabled capture can apply the same rules across the estate. A branch office, warehouse or remote worker can submit documents into a consistent process without relying on local workarounds.


Classify, extract and validate

Once captured, software can separate batches, identify document types and extract agreed fields. Not every workflow needs sophisticated automation. A simple rule that names files consistently and sends them to the right team can deliver a meaningful improvement.

Where data extraction is required, build in validation. For example, an invoice can be checked against an expected supplier format or purchase order reference before it reaches an approver. Exceptions can be directed to a defined queue rather than disappearing into an inbox. This gives teams a practical balance between automation and control.


Route information, not just files

The most useful workflows move documents into the place where the next decision is made. That may mean passing invoice data to finance, attaching service records to a customer account or storing a signed document against an employee file.

Before selecting software, map the hand-offs. Ask who receives the document, what decision they make, which information they need and what should happen if the document is incomplete. This reveals whether a simple scan-to-folder process is enough or whether integration and approval rules are needed.


Build the workflow around the business process

A successful implementation starts with a focused process, not a long list of features. Choose one workflow that creates regular administrative pressure and has a measurable outcome, such as shortening approval delays, reducing rekeying or improving document retrieval.

First, establish how documents currently arrive and where they stall. Include the informal steps that are easy to overlook: printing an email for approval, forwarding documents between mailboxes or keeping a temporary desktop folder. These are often the points where security and accountability weaken.

Next, agree the minimum information needed from each document. An accounts workflow may require a supplier name, invoice number, date, amount and purchase order number. A service workflow may need a customer reference, job number and engineer notes. Capturing more data than anyone uses adds complexity without improving the process.

Then define ownership. Someone should be responsible for exceptions, workflow changes and user feedback after launch. Software cannot compensate for unclear approval responsibilities. If a document waits because nobody knows who should approve it, automation will make the delay more visible but will not solve it.

Finally, test with real documents and real users. Include poor-quality scans, duplicate documents and unusual layouts. A workflow that works only in a demonstration is unlikely to survive daily office use. User training should cover the reasons for the process as well as the buttons to press, particularly where staff are moving away from familiar paper routines.


Security and governance need to be designed in

Document capture can improve security, but only when the workflow is configured with appropriate controls. Sending scanned information to a generic mailbox or unrestricted shared drive may be convenient, yet it leaves little clarity over who has accessed, changed or retained a document.

Consider authentication at the device, role-based access to destinations, secure release for printed material and audit trails for workflow actions. Retention policies also deserve attention. A document should be kept for the required period, but not indefinitely simply because storage is available.

This is especially relevant for organisations handling employee records, financial data, customer information or commercially sensitive contracts. The capture process should support existing information governance rather than becoming an unmanaged route around it. IT, finance, operations and compliance stakeholders may all have legitimate requirements, so early agreement prevents expensive rework later.


Choosing document capture software that will be used

The best option depends on document volumes, existing systems, device estate and the level of automation required. A smaller organisation may benefit most from dependable scan routing, searchable files and clear user permissions. A larger or more document-intensive operation may require extraction, validation, integrations and detailed audit reporting.

Avoid buying solely on the promise of automation. Ask how the software handles exceptions, how easily workflows can be adjusted and what support is available after deployment. Also consider the everyday user experience at the multifunction device. If the process takes too many steps, users will revert to email, paper copies or personal folders.
